So my friends and I have never been here before and wanted to try out something new. We made a reservation 2 days in advance so there was no waiting time. My friends were on time and I of course was running late AGAIN so when I got there at ten past seven I had to wait an additional 15 mins for the lift. As this restaurant is on the 6th floor, there are a tonne of people waiting to go for dinner.

We were seated in a very comfortable booth with a lot of privacy, there was a high partition so we couldn't even see the table next to us and the tables behind and in front couldn't hear us talking. Bonus points


As I was late, the girls ordered and were eating already, as you can see from the pics
The appetizers were about 8 dishes of Korean snacks like kimichi, marinated potatoes, assorted veggies, etc.
Korean appetizers

It was just 3 girls so we ordered 2 x marinated beef short rib meat, 1 x spicy cuttlefish, 1 x marinated pork bone, beef bone soup and stone pot rice and we were super full.

The beef short ribs were very tasty, good marinate and very tender. The pork bone was good as well, but they cut the meat a bit thick. For me, the was the stone pot rice, it was very good because the rice at the bottom was thick and crispy, just the way it should be without being burnt. Good dining experience, they gave us free ice cream at the end of the meal. The only problem was the staff, it seemed like there wasn't enough staff walking around to serve the almost full restaurant.
